Hennessey’s Dodge Challenger SRT Demon 170 Will Push Up To 1,700 Horsepower

In the world of high-performance vehicles, Hennessey Special Operations (HSO) is set to redefine the limits with its latest creation, the Demon 1700 Twin Turbo. This groundbreaking project, priced at $200,000 excluding the donor vehicle, promises an unparalleled driving experience, boasting an astonishing 1,700 horsepower on E85 fuel. Blueprinted Motor and Transmission

Unlike conventional Hennessey kits that rely on larger superchargers for added power, the Demon 1700 Twin Turbo takes a revolutionary approach. The stock 1,025-horsepower engine undergoes a meticulous process of being pulled and shrink-wrapped for secure storage, only to be replaced by a blueprinted motor and transmission. This move ensures not just power but precision, a hallmark of Hennessey’s commitment to excellence.

The beating heart of the Demon 1700 is its reliance on two Precision 7576 turbos, propelling it to the extraordinary 1,700 horsepower mark. Running on E85, this setup contributes to a quarter-mile time of a staggering 7.9 seconds at 175 mph. This performance places it firmly ahead of its stock counterpart, certified by NHRA at 8.91 seconds at 151.17 mph, and even outshines the Rimac Nevera’s 8.25-second quarter-mile sprint.

Forged Internals and Advanced Alloys

Hennessey leaves no stone unturned in crafting the Demon 1700’s engine. While the specifics of the displacement remain undisclosed, the engine features forged internals and utilizes unique alloys. This commitment to motorsports technology ensures not just power but durability, a testament to Hennessey’s pursuit of perfection.

The Birth of Hennessey Special Operations

Niche Production and Exclusivity

HSO marks the third arm of Hennessey’s automotive empire, joining HPE and Hennessey Special Vehicles. However, HSO stands out by focusing on low-volume, ultra-high-horsepower builds. With a commitment to producing only 15-20 vehicles annually, HSO introduces a level of exclusivity that resonates with enthusiasts seeking a unique driving experience.
